![]() Cryolab Publishes 2026 Buyer Guide for Liquid Nitrogen Dewars in UK IVF LaboratoriesBy: Cryolab Ltd What does the guide cover? The guide covers the clinical criteria that matter most for IVF laboratory dewar selection: hold time under clinical access conditions, neck diameter and daily usability, storage capacity calculated from canister configuration, safety features, consumable compatibility, and HFEA compliance documentation requirements. It also covers total cost of ownership modelling, including LN2 consumption rates over the vessel's working life. Which vessels does the guide recommend? " After 40 years supplying UK IVF laboratories, the recurring procurement error is buying on purchase price without modelling LN2 consumption. Over five years, running costs from a poorly insulated vessel can exceed the original price gap. " About Cryolab Ltd Cryolab Ltd (cryolab.co.uk) Full guide at cryolab.co.uk/ End
